Существует ли библиотека Python для подключения к серверу PostgreSQL 8.4 с использованием проверки подлинности сертификата? - PullRequest
0 голосов
/ 22 января 2010

Мы в процессе обновления с PostgreSQL 8.3 до PostgreSQL 8.4, в значительной степени, чтобы мы могли начать использовать аутентификацию на основе сертификатов .

У нас есть некоторый код Python 2.x, который обращается к базе данных, которая использует PyGreSQL . Есть ли способ получить его или любую другую библиотеку Python для использования сертификата для доступа к PostgreSQL?

Просматривая исходный код PyGreSQL, я не нашел способа предоставить сертификат.

1 Ответ

2 голосов
/ 22 января 2010

psycopg2 основан на libpq, поэтому он должен работать там. Я не думаю, что есть специальный интерфейс для него, поэтому вам придется использовать переменные окружения (см. Документацию libpq) для управления им, но он должен работать. (отказ от ответственности: я на самом деле не пробовал, но что-нибудь поверх libpq должно работать)

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...